IndiGo waives change fee on bookings done till April 30
MUMBAI: In a move to encourage flight bookings, IndiGo on Friday announced that it will waive off change fees on new air ticket purchases made from April 17 till April 30.
Under the offer, passengers have been allowed to make unlimited changes on regular fare new bookings made till April 30. But if a passenger cancels the ticket, the cancellation fee will apply, the airline said. The offer is valid on bookings made through travel agents, online travel portals as well.
Said a travel agent requesting anonymity: “What we saw last year when Covid cases were on the rise was that people didn’t go for advance purchases. Majority booked tickets 2-3 days in advance and that trend appears to have returned. Quite a few surveys on passenger sentiment towards air travel during the pandemic have indicated that one of the ways to encourage travel is to waive off fees that come with changing or cancelling an air ticket.
